Welcome to on-call for the Glimmerpane design system! Our snapshot tests live in the `snapcheck` suite and run on every merge to main. If a UI component changes visually, the diff bot flags it — usually it's an intentional tweak, so just approve the new baseline. If it's 2am and snapshots are failing across the board, it's almost always a font-loading race, not your problem. To unlock the baseline store and re-approve snapshots in bulk, use the recovery passphrase below.

recovery phrase for tahag-taguf: wenix-caswyn

Handover note — Crumbwheel order cutoffs.

Welcome aboard. The bakery cutoff rule in Crumbwheel closes same-day orders at 14:00 local to each storefront, not UTC — this has bitten us twice. Holiday overrides live in the calendar service and take precedence silently, so always check there first when a cutoff looks wrong. To unlock the calendar service's admin console after a restart, enter the recovery passphrase below.

vault phrase of bagap-bahaf = silion-pelox-sorox-casdor-quenwyn-fraax-eliox-praael-kelion-quenvan-kasox-rusael-norius-belvan

The proposed plan adds 34 roles across Veldane Systems, weighted toward the Corsa platform engineering group and the Tillbrook support center. Attrition modeling assumes 9% voluntary turnover, consistent with the past two years. Contractor conversion accounts for 11 of the new positions, reducing agency spend meaningfully. Regional salary benchmarks have been refreshed for the Ostlin market. One assumption underpinning the second-half hiring wave is tied to a sensitive matter noted below.

internal memo for tafog-kageg: Headcount on the Tamion team goes from 9 to 94 by the end of May. Gross margin on Tamion came in at 23 percent against a plan of 58 percent.

Subject: Bakery order-cutoff rule — release contents

Hi release manager,

This release changes the order-cutoff logic for the Ovenlight storefront. Orders placed after 14:00 local bakery time now roll to the next production day instead of being rejected, and the Crumbwell scheduler recalculates batch sizes accordingly. Please verify the cutoff setting in staging before promotion, since the Millbrae shops run a different timezone configuration. The candidate build is identified by the token below.

build token for kagaf-hahof: htk14_9d3d4d26d7d8de